Death of a Loved One


Picture

We offer support and comfort in those times of grief and loss.

Burial Services
The church is always ready to assist in creating a special service to celebrate the life of a loved one. Please fill out form below to begin arrangements.

Burial Arrangements - Columbarium
Saint Anthony has a Memorial Garden and Columbarium available to members and their families.  Information on costs and reserving a niche can be made by filling out the form below.

Grief Support Program
Walking the Mourner’s Path is an eight-week, Christ-centered program offering support to those who have experienced the death of a loved one.  Small group workshops are led by trained facilitators.  Participants will discover tools for moving forward in their lives while also reflecting on ways to honor their loved one.  Workshops are offered periodically throughout the year.  For more information on the national Walking the Mourners Path ministry, owned by Saint Anthony click here.
